Qt 3 Support Members for QWidget
The following class members are part of the Qt 3 support layer. They are provided to help you port old code to Qt 4. We advise against using them in new code.

Member Function Documentation
QWidget::QWidget ( QWidget * parent, const char * name, Qt::WindowFlags f = 0 )
This is an overloaded function.
Qt::BackgroundMode QWidget::backgroundMode () const
Returns the color role used for painting the widget's background.
Use QPalette(backgroundRole(()) instead.
See also setBackgroundMode().
QPoint QWidget::backgroundOffset () const
Always returns QPoint().
BackgroundOrigin QWidget::backgroundOrigin () const
Always returns WindowOrigin.
See also setBackgroundOrigin().
QString QWidget::caption () const
Use windowTitle() instead.
See also setCaption().
QWidget * QWidget::childAt ( int x, int y, bool includeThis ) const
Use the childAt() overload that doesn't have an includeThis parameter.
For example, if you have code like
return widget->childAt(x, y, true);
you can rewrite it as
QWidget *child = widget->childAt(x, y, true); if (child) return child; if (widget->rect().contains(x, y)) return widget;
QWidget * QWidget::childAt ( const QPoint & p, bool includeThis ) const
Use the single point argument overload instead.
bool QWidget::close ( bool alsoDelete )
Closes the widget.
Use the no-argument overload instead.
QColorGroup QWidget::colorGroup () const
Use QColorGroup(palette()) instead.
void QWidget::constPolish () const
Use ensurePolished() instead.
void QWidget::drawText ( const QPoint & p, const QString & s )
Drawing may only take place in a QPaintEvent. Overload paintEvent() to do your drawing and call update() to schedule a replaint whenever necessary. See also QPainter.
void QWidget::drawText ( int x, int y, const QString & s )
Drawing may only take place in a QPaintEvent. Overload paintEvent() to do your drawing and call update() to schedule a replaint whenever necessary. See also QPainter.
void QWidget::erase ()
Drawing may only take place in a QPaintEvent. Overload paintEvent() to do your erasing and call update() to schedule a replaint whenever necessary. See also QPainter.
void QWidget::erase ( int x, int y, int w, int h )
Drawing may only take place in a QPaintEvent. Overload paintEvent() to do your erasing and call update() to schedule a replaint whenever necessary. See also QPainter.
void QWidget::erase ( const QRect & rect )
Drawing may only take place in a QPaintEvent. Overload paintEvent() to do your erasing and call update() to schedule a replaint whenever necessary. See also QPainter.
void QWidget::erase ( const QRegion & rgn )
This is an overloaded function.
Clear the given region, rgn.
Drawing may only take place in a QPaintEvent. Overload paintEvent() to do your erasing and call update() to schedule a replaint whenever necessary. See also QPainter.
bool QWidget::hasMouse () const
Use testAttribute(Qt::WA_UnderMouse) instead.
const QPixmap * QWidget::icon () const
Return's the widget's icon.
Use windowIcon() instead.
See also setIcon().
QString QWidget::iconText () const
Use windowIconText() instead.
See also setIconText().
void QWidget::iconify ()
Use showMinimized() instead.
bool QWidget::isDesktop () const
Use windowType() == Qt::Desktop instead.
bool QWidget::isDialog () const
Use windowType() == Qt::Dialog instead.
bool QWidget::isInputMethodEnabled () const
Use testAttribute(Qt::WA_InputMethodEnabled) instead.
bool QWidget::isPopup () const
Use windowType() == Qt::Popup instead.
bool QWidget::isShown () const
Use !isHidden() instead (notice the exclamation mark), or use isVisible() to check whether the widget is visible.
bool QWidget::isUpdatesEnabled () const
Use the updatesEnabled property instead.
bool QWidget::isVisibleToTLW () const
Use isVisible() instead.
bool QWidget::ownCursor () const
Use testAttribute(Qt::WA_SetCursor) instead.
bool QWidget::ownFont () const
Use testAttribute(Qt::WA_SetFont) instead.
bool QWidget::ownPalette () const
Use testAttribute(Qt::WA_SetPalette) instead.
QWidget * QWidget::parentWidget ( bool sameWindow ) const
Use the no-argument overload instead.
void QWidget::polish ()
Use ensurePolished() instead.
void QWidget::recreate ( QWidget * parent, Qt::WindowFlags f, const QPoint & p, bool showIt = false )
Use setParent() to change the parent or the widget's widget flags; use move() to move the widget, and use show() to show the widget.
void QWidget::repaint ( bool b )
The boolean parameter b is ignored. Use the no-argument overload instead.
void QWidget::repaint ( int x, int y, int w, int h, bool b )
The boolean parameter b is ignored. Use the four-argument overload instead.
void QWidget::repaint ( const QRect & r, bool b )
The boolean parameter b is ignored. Use the single rect-argument overload instead.
void QWidget::repaint ( const QRegion & rgn, bool b )
The boolean parameter b is ignored. Use the single region-argument overload instead.
void QWidget::reparent ( QWidget * parent, Qt::WindowFlags f, const QPoint & p, bool showIt = false )
Use setParent() to change the parent or the widget's widget flags; use move() to move the widget, and use show() to show the widget.
void QWidget::reparent ( QWidget * parent, const QPoint & p, bool showIt = false )
Use setParent() to change the parent; use move() to move the widget, and use show() to show the widget.
void QWidget::setActiveWindow ()
Use activateWindow() instead.
See also isActiveWindow().
void QWidget::setBackgroundColor ( const QColor & color )
Use the palette instead.
For example, if you have code like
widget->setBackgroundColor(color);
you can rewrite it as
QPalette palette; palette.setColor(widget->backgroundRole(), color); widget->setPalette(palette);
void QWidget::setBackgroundMode ( Qt::BackgroundMode widgetBackground, Qt::BackgroundMode paletteBackground = Qt::PaletteBackground )
Sets the color role used for painting the widget's background to background mode widgetBackground. The paletteBackground mode parameter is ignored.
See also backgroundMode().
void QWidget::setBackgroundOrigin ( BackgroundOrigin background )
See also backgroundOrigin().
void QWidget::setBackgroundPixmap ( const QPixmap & pixmap )
Use the palette instead.
For example, if you have code like
widget->setBackgroundPixmap(pixmap);
you can rewrite it as
QPalette palette; palette.setBrush(widget->backgroundRole(), QBrush(pixmap)); widget->setPalette(palette);
void QWidget::setCaption ( const QString & c )
Use setWindowTitle() instead.
See also caption().
void QWidget::setEraseColor ( const QColor & color )
Use the palette instead.
For example, if you have code like
widget->setEraseColor(color);
you can rewrite it as
QPalette palette; palette.setColor(widget->backgroundRole(), color); widget->setPalette(palette);
void QWidget::setErasePixmap ( const QPixmap & pixmap )
Use the palette instead.
For example, if you have code like
widget->setErasePixmap(pixmap);
you can rewrite it as
QPalette palette; palette.setBrush(widget->backgroundRole(), QBrush(pixmap)); widget->setPalette(palette);
void QWidget::setFont ( const QFont & f, bool b )
Use the single-argument overload instead.
void QWidget::setIcon ( const QPixmap & i )
Use setWindowIcon() instead.
See also icon().
void QWidget::setIconText ( const QString & it )
Use setWindowIconText() instead.
See also iconText().
void QWidget::setInputMethodEnabled ( bool enabled )
Use setAttribute(Qt::WA_InputMethodEnabled, enabled) instead.
See also isInputMethodEnabled().
void QWidget::setKeyCompression ( bool b )
Use setAttribute(Qt::WA_KeyCompression, b) instead.
void QWidget::setPalette ( const QPalette & p, bool b )
Use the single-argument overload instead.
void QWidget::setPaletteBackgroundColor ( const QColor & color )
Use the palette directly.
For example, if you have code like
widget->setPaletteBackgroundColor(color);
you can rewrite it as
QPalette palette; palette.setColor(widget->backgroundRole(), color); widget->setPalette(palette);
void QWidget::setPaletteBackgroundPixmap ( const QPixmap & pixmap )
Use the palette directly.
For example, if you have code like
widget->setPaletteBackgroundPixmap(pixmap);
you can rewrite it as
QPalette palette; palette.setBrush(widget->backgroundRole(), QBrush(pixmap)); widget->setPalette(palette);
void QWidget::setPaletteForegroundColor ( const QColor & color )
Use the palette directly.
For example, if you have code like
widget->setPaletteForegroundColor(color);
you can rewrite it as
QPalette palette; palette.setColor(widget->foregroundRole(), color); widget->setPalette(palette);
void QWidget::setShown ( bool shown ) [slot]
Use setVisible(shown) instead.
See also isShown().
void QWidget::setSizePolicy ( QSizePolicy::Policy hor, QSizePolicy::Policy ver, bool hfw )
Use the sizePolicy property and heightForWidth() function instead.
QStyle * QWidget::setStyle ( const QString & style )
This is an overloaded function.
Sets the widget's GUI style to style using the QStyleFactory.
void QWidget::unsetFont ()
Use setFont(QFont()) instead.
void QWidget::unsetPalette ()
Use setPalette(QPalette()) instead.
QRect QWidget::visibleRect () const
Use visibleRegion() instead.
QWidgetMapper * QWidget::wmapper () [static]
The widget mapper is no longer part of the public API.
